Two different brand of vcr will not record uhf channels. Uhf stations will not play on the tv thru the vcr tuners. Is this because of weak signal? They are running off of rabbit ears. Tv tuner plays uhf fine on rabit ears.

    I hate to answer a question with a question but are the vcrs that you are trying to use capable of recieving UHF channels? I would go into the menu setup on the VCR and see if there is a tuner selection, If so then set to air if it has that selection, Or antenna if it has that selection I checked mine and it Does Not have a selection for air or antenna, it only has cable, line 1 and line 2, in the menu so mine will not recieve UHF channels, Even though my tv will.
